How Our Residential Fence Repair Process Works

With Legendary Fence Company Fresno, residential fence repair follows a simple but detailed process so you know what is happening at each step.

1. On site evaluation: We meet you at your Fresno home, walk the fence line with you, listen to what you have noticed, and take measurements and photos. We test posts by hand, look at how deep they are set, and check where sprinklers, downspouts, and irrigation lines could be affecting the wood or metal.

2. Written repair estimate: You receive a written estimate that lists each repair area. For example, β€œreset 5 posts at northeast corner,” β€œreplace 22 cedar pickets along alley side,” or β€œinstall new 6 ft gate frame with upgraded hinges.” Pricing is broken out so you can see what you are paying for, and we note what is critical versus cosmetic.

3. Material match and approvals: Whenever possible we match your existing fence style, height, and color. If your fence is older and the exact material is no longer available, we show you side by side options and explain which will blend best after weathering in the Fresno sun. Once you approve, we schedule the work on a day that fits your routine.

4. Repair day: Our crew protects landscaping where we will be working, then removes only what needs to come out. For wood fences, we pull or cut damaged sections and set new posts in concrete, then reinstall or replace rails and pickets so lines stay straight and level. For vinyl and metal, we straighten or reset posts, replace damaged panels or pickets, and reattach or upgrade hardware.

5. Final walkthrough and clean up: Before we leave, we walk the job with you, check gate alignment and latch function, and make sure everything is solid and meets the plan we agreed on. We haul away all debris, old concrete chunks, and extra material so you are not left with a pile of scraps in the yard.

Common Fresno Fence Problems We Fix All the Time

Fresno’s climate creates some very specific fence issues, and our residential fence repair service is tailored to those local conditions.

Sun and heat damage: The Central Valley sun is rough on wood fences. Boards dry out, crack, and warp, which leaves gaps and weak spots. We often replace individual pickets or entire runs of boards, then recommend sealants or stain options that hold up better in Fresno’s heat so you get more life out of the repair.

Rot at the base: Sprinklers that hit the fence, poorly draining soil, and lawn buildup against the bottom of the fence all cause rot. We trim away soil where it is high, reposition or suggest adjustments to sprinkler heads, then replace the rotted sections and, when needed, upgrade to pressure treated posts or use metal post anchors where appropriate.

Leaning fences and sinking posts: Many older Fresno fences were set with shallow or minimal concrete. Over time, that leads to entire sections leaning after winter rains or irrigation saturation. We excavate around those posts, remove old loose concrete, and reset new posts at the proper depth, usually 24 to 30 inches or more, with fresh concrete that is bell shaped at the bottom for better hold.

Wind damaged panels: Seasonal winds and dust storms can knock panels loose or pull them from posts, especially on corner lots or open areas. We reattach panels with upgraded fasteners, reinforce rails, and, in some cases, add additional bracing on the windward side to reduce future movement.

Gate issues: A huge share of repair calls in Fresno are for gates that will not close, drag, or have broken latches. Our team realigns gate posts, adjusts or replaces hinges, installs stronger frames if needed, and adds child safe or lockable latches so your entrance is easy to use but secure.

Materials, Design Options, and What Affects Repair Cost

Every residential fence repair is a little different, but the same core factors usually affect cost, timeline, and material choices.

Material type: Wood repairs are typically the most common and often the most affordable for small fixes, like replacing pickets or short rails. Vinyl repairs cost more per piece but are often quicker because panels snap into place. Chain link repairs can be economical when only fabric or a short section of top rail is damaged. Ornamental iron or steel repairs are more specialized and may require fabrication or welding.

Extent of structural damage: Replacing a few pickets is inexpensive. Resetting multiple posts that have shifted due to soil movement or poor installation is more involved, since it requires concrete work and careful line and height matching. During your estimate, Legendary Fence Company Fresno separates cosmetic fixes from structural ones so you can decide where to invest.

Access and terrain: Backyards with limited side access, steep slopes, or lots of mature landscaping take more time to work in, which can affect labor cost. We plan for this upfront so there are no surprise charges later.

Matching vs upgrading: If you are planning to sell soon, you might want a straightforward match to your current fence so it blends in and passes inspection. If you plan to stay long term, it may make sense to upgrade sections during repair, such as using heavier posts, corrosion resistant fasteners, or a higher grade wood. We explain both options in plain language so you can choose based on budget and how long you expect the fence to last.

Permits and neighbor coordination: Most small repairs in Fresno do not require a permit, especially if the fence height and location are not changing. If you are on a shared property line, we can give you clear documentation and photos you can share with your neighbor so everyone understands the work being done and the cost split if you choose to share expenses.
